3
Archaelogical Complex Nebet Tepe
Ruins of the old village and fortress where the ancient city was founded 4000 years BC.

4
Ethnographic Museum
The building of the museum was built in 1847 and is a stunning masterpiece from Bulgarian Revival period. The museum keeps one of the biggest collections of Bulgarian cultural heritage.

5
House-Museum Hindlian
The house of Stepan Hindliyan is one of the few houses in Plovdiv which has preserved its original symmetric design from the Revival period.

6
Ancient Theatre of Philippopolis
One of the best preserved ancient Roman theaters. It was built in the 1st century.

8
Assenova krepost (Asen's Fortress)
The fortress played an important role in defending the route from the Aegean Sea to Thrace. It is perched on top of a hill in the beautiful Rhodope Mountains and reveals breathtaking views.

9
Bachkovo Monastery
The second largest monastery in Bulgaria with one of the oldest iconostasis in the country and the miraculous icon of the Virgin Mary.
